Jobs/Vacancies › Linestech Solution Owners Of Vira.ng, PAY ME!!! by Abraham18(op): 9:34am On Nov 10, 2020 |
I'm a freelance writer, and I was employed to write some articles for vira.ng, which I accepted not because they promised to pay handsomely but because I'm trying to build a relationship with them. I wrote about 50 non-plagiarized articles for the website (Vira.ng), which have been published on their site. They agreed to pay monthly; since I completed the article, they have stopped returning my chats on WhatsApp.
I sent emails several times, but none got a reply from them; they are expected to pay me #17,500 for all 50 articles. I'm writing this so another young writer won't fall victim to them. They are also the owner of Linestech Solution. Here is their number

Jobs/Vacancies › Vacancy: Front End Web Developer by Abraham18(op): 4:31pm On Jun 19, 2020 |
Front End Web Developer (HTML, CSS, JavaScript & WordPress) at technology solutions company
Location: Lagos
• Solid software design skills and experience with automated UI testing. • Good knowledge of front end technologies like CSS, HTML, JavaScript, php and Wordpress (High proficiency in Elementor). • Extensive hands-on experience in JavaScript. • Familiarity with JavaScript libraries like jQuery and Proficiency with Node.js, Express and use of Api
How to Apply
Send your CV to info@talent24ng.com using the Job Title as the subject of the mail. |
